Desafío de AlgoritmosVersion en ligne Descubre qué tan bien conoces los algoritmos. par montserrat 1 Es independiente del lenguaje de programación en el que se implemente. Sí No 2 Un algoritmo es una secuencia finita de pasos bien definidos para resolver un problema. Sí No 3 Un algoritmo es una serie de pasos finitos y bien definidos para realizar una tarea. Sí No 4 El rendimiento de un algoritmo es siempre el mismo en cualquier ordenador. Sí No 5 Un algoritmo siempre termina en una sola iteración. Sí No 6 Un algoritmo para buscar siempre termina en cualquier caso. Sí No 7 Un algoritmo que no tiene condiciones de ramificación nunca puede devolver diferentes respuestas. Sí No 8 Un algoritmo no puede representar bifurcaciones o decisiones. Sí No 9 Un algoritmo determinista produce el mismo resultado con las mismas entradas. Sí No 10 Un algoritmo puede ser probabilístico y usar variables aleatorias. Sí No 11 Un algoritmo no puede usar estructuras de datos dinámicas como pilas o colas. Sí No 12 La complejidad temporal de un algoritmo se expresa en función del tamaño de la entrada. Sí No 13 Debe terminar después de un número finito de pasos para ser útil. Sí No 14 Todos los algoritmos de ordenación requieren comparaciones entre elementos. Sí No 15 Todos los programas son exactamente iguales a sus algoritmos en todos los casos. Sí No 16 Puede contener variables, decisiones y bucles. Sí No 17 Los algoritmos pueden describirse usando pseudocódigo o diagramas de flujo. Sí No 18 Puede ser representado por un diagrama de flujo o pseudocódigo. Sí No 19 Un algoritmo no necesita finito de pasos. Sí No 20 Toda implementación de software ya es un algoritmo, por lo que no hay diferencias. Sí No